This month's theme, chosen by Random Member, is:'REFLECTIONS'.

THE THEME wrote:
'Reflections, in all forms, whether the reflection of a sight, or the reflection of time/memories past, or any other way you can think to approach the theme.


Here's how to take part:

1]Take a picture, based on the theme (think direct, think laterally - it doesn't matter - it's your idea and creativity that people are looking forward to seeing)

2]Upload it anonymously to the Eggwan account (obviously, don't call it 'Mimi's picture of reflections' or anything that makes it too obviously yours)

3]Try not to make it too obvious that a picture is yours in particular by announcing your upload, etc.


Upload your 'REFLECTIONS' photos to the same-titled folder in the Eggwan Gallery. (If you would like to take part in this contest and do not have the username and password to sign in to the Eggwan gallery for anonymous uploading, please PM me for details*).


This contest ends at MIDDAYpm on MONDAY 18th August. Good luck and happy snapping!



(*PM-ing me, rather than asking in-thread just means that I am much less likely to miss your request, but it also means that it is far less likely that people will know which picture is yours by the fact that it was uploaded a short time after you asked :) )
